Welcome to CPAB – Canada’s Public Company Audit Regulator

The Canadian Public Accountability Board oversees public accounting firms that audit reporting issuers. We promote audit quality through proactive regulation, robust audit assessments, dialogue with domestic and international stakeholders, and practicable insights that inform capital market participants and contribute to public confidence in the integrity of financial reporting.

We do important work, and we need remarkable people on our team

We are recruiting for an Associate Director, Inspections to join our Team.

You have the following qualifications and competencies:

  • A minimum of 7 years progressive public company accounting and audit experience at a Big Four or other national accounting firm.
  • CPA designation is required.
  • In-depth knowledge of IFRS and Canadian Auditing Standards; US GAAP is also an asset.
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Ability to work independently and as a member of a team.
  • Ability to travel, approximately up to 6 weeks per year.

Who you are?

As an ambassador for CPAB and the accounting profession, you :

  • are passionate about auditing and conduct your work with the utmost of integrity and professionalism.
  • think strategically and analytically in solving complex accounting or auditing issues.
  • are seen as a leader and an influencer; you have the ability to articulate your views and understand the point of view of others and build consensus; written and verbal communication is impactful.
  • are a strong team player, collaborating with and assisting others; you ask for help and consult when necessary.
  • possess strong time management and project management skills with the ability to manage competing demands.
  • are flexible and adaptive to change and are keen to share your ideas and thoughts on ways to improve.
  • are curious with a willingness to learn and embrace the future of audit and new industries and tools.
  • are self-motivated and thrive in and like to contribute to an intellectually stimulating environment.

What you will be doing:

As a member of a highly skilled team the Associate Director, Inspections role involves:

  • Conducting inspections of audit firms (both public company audit files and the Firm’s quality management systems) in accordance with CPAB’s inspection methodology. This will include discussions with the audit Firm’s engagement teams and members of the Firm’s leadership.
  • Maintaining control of assigned inspection work, including meeting deadlines and conducting the inspection in an efficient and effective manner.
  • Fostering professional, productive and respectful working relationships with colleagues, the firms and other external stakeholders, such that all interfaces reflect positively on CPAB and underscore the importance of the organization’s mission and advance the integrity of financial reporting.
  • Preparing high quality written reports.
  • Participating in inspection projects aimed at enhancing the effectiveness of CPAB’s inspection processes.
  • Supporting stakeholder engagement and thought leadership initiatives.
  • Some travel throughout the year.
